How to Deal With High School Locker Rooms

You can deal with high school locker rooms by keeping yourself calm, cool, collected and following these suggestions.

Instructions

    • 1

      Act natural. Even though it may feel like the most unnatural and exposed thing in the world to get naked and shower in front of a bunch of classmates, pretend it’s as mundane as brushing your teeth. Your natural act will exude confidence and deter people from picking on you. It’s the same tactic used when you are lost on the street but don’t want to get mugged so you pretend to know exactly where you’re going.

    • 2

      Wear boring underwear and bring a boring towel. Boring underwear means a simple bikini or brief cut in a solid color with no holes. Never don anything people can make fun of, like granny briefs, a leather thong or underwear with cartoon characters on them. The same goes for the towel. Make it a solid-colored beach or bathroom towel that is large enough to wrap around you without having your butt stick out.

    • 3

      Ignore taunts. If you do become the object of teasing and taunts, don’t answer back. Simply ignore the hecklers and go about your business as if you don’t even hear them. Never let them see the taunts are bothering you. They will most likely get bored with you if you do not react and move on to the next person.

    • 4

      Mind your own business. Never stare at other people in the locker room, especially at their naked body parts and don’t engage in harassing others. Sure, you can chat with friends in there, but don’t join them if they are taunting anyone else. Just think how you would feel if you were on the receiving end of the taunts.

    • 5

      Move fast. Your goal is to get in and out of the locker room as quickly as possible. Make it a game for yourself and see if you can properly shower, get dressed and get out in less than five minutes. Maybe you’ll start a trend and everyone will be so busy trying to move fast that they won’t have time to taunt anyone else.

Tips & Warnings

  • Even though wearing flip flops may be considered paranoid or geeky, do it anyway. Locker rooms are not the best place to go barefoot due to the bacteria, fungus and athlete’s foot that lurk on the tiles.

  • If you react to taunts, it will only encourage more taunts. Don't let them see you cringe.

  • Even if you are wholly embarrassed being naked, don’t shower with your clothes or underwear on. That’s just gross and extremely inviting for hecklers.
